Neverovich: gas will be cheaper in Lithuania only when LNG starts operating
Lithuanian Minister of Energy Jaroslav Neverovich names to ways to cut heating prices: by using more biofuel and creating competition. The minister says that the gas price may start falling already in 2013, but the actual drop will be felt by residents only when the liquefied natural gas (LNG) terminal starts operating, informs LETA/ELTA....
